To add widgets to your iPad's home screen, you just need to hold your finger on a blank part of the home screen, then tap the plus sign icon.
Using widgets on your iPad enhances customization significantly. Similar to the iPhone, widgets provide quick access to information and app functions. However, iPadOS offers even greater flexibility.
